  • Patent number: 5303813
    Abstract: Sealing apron device for a moving conveyor belt or loading trough of a belt conveyor, has at least one mounting plate which is fitted above the belt and which has a vertically adjustable sealing apron on a side wall. The underside of the apron interacts with the belt for sealing, and the sealing apron comprises a number of adjacent sections which are vertically slidable relative to each other on the mounting plate by means of slide guides on the mounting plate and the apron sections respectively. Each apron section is so fixed to the mounting plate with a clamping plate or bracket and fixing members that an apron section is clamped between the clamping plate and the mounting plate. A friction element between the clamping plate and sealing apron sections permits a downward movement of the section relative to the mounting plate, but impede an upward movement thereof.

  • Patent number: 4703869
    Abstract: An air cannon which includes a pressure tank with an inlet opening and an outlet opening for air, whereby the outlet opening is composed of a tube which is airtightly fastened in the wall of the pressure tank and the one open end terminates inside the pressure tank and the other open end extends out of the pressure tank. A cylindrical shaped second tube is fixed in the pressure tank with an open end and a closed end, generally concentric to the mentioned first tube, of which the cross section is larger than the cross section of the first tube. The first tube extends through the open end into the inside of the second tube, and is generally concentric to it. In the bottom of the second tube there is provided an in and outlet opening for the in and outflow of air.
